Ref.: "AFAIK markups do not handle page breaks" Maybe it depends on what you mean by "handle". I found, by accident almost, that you can insert page breaks manually into a long stretch of text by cutting it manually into chunks that fill a page. That is: You stop a " marked up page" by inserting }%End of markup \pageBreak and then start the next markup page. And so forth. It is not elegant and it requires a sort of manually fitting of the text on the pages but at least it works. Best regards, Robert Blackstone |
